Three Lions Die in One Week at Tama Zoological Park

Extreme summer heatwaves in Japan have caused the deaths of three lions at Tama Zoological Park west of Tokyo, according to the Tokyo Zoological Park Society and BBC reports. The fatalities—involving lionesses aged three, eleven, and fifteen—stemmed from severe dehydration and multi-organ failure brought on by high temperatures and humidity, officials said.

Tama Zoological Park Lion Deaths Highlight Heat Risks for Zoo Animals

According to Miwa Kosaka of the zoo, staff have never experienced a situation where multiple lions succumbed to weather-related illnesses. Last year brought high temperatures, but no animals fell ill in this manner.

The fatalities unfolded rapidly over the course of a single week. Three-year-old Mugi first lost her appetite on July 19. By the following day, she could no longer stand. Despite receiving fluids, vitamins, and cooling interventions from zookeepers, Mugi died on July 28. Eleven-year-old Ichigo died three days later, followed by fifteen-year-old Luena on Sunday.

Autopsy results confirmed that all three lionesses suffered from severe dehydration and multi-organ failure. The facility now reports that three other lions remain too sick to stand. Four animals show signs of recovery, while six have remained healthy so far, according to BBC reporting.

Why High Humidity and Heat Threaten Lions in Captivity

Lions are particularly vulnerable to extreme weather conditions because they do not regulate body temperature through sweating like humans do. Professor Hideaki Karaki, a professor of veterinary medicine at the University of Tokyo, explained to local media that lions cool themselves primarily by panting.

Did you know? While lions in the wild typically live between 10 and 14 years, individuals in captivity can reach up to 20 years of age. High humidity combined with scorching temperatures severely hampers a lion’s ability to cool down via panting.

When high air temperature is paired with dense humidity, the cooling process breaks down. In response to the crisis, Tama Zoological Park has deployed portable air conditioning units and powerful industrial fans inside the lion enclosures to lower ambient temperatures and protect the surviving animals.

Broader Impacts of Japan’s Record-Breaking Summer Temperatures

The lethal heatwaves are not isolated to zoological facilities. Japanese meteorological authorities have issued widespread heatstroke warnings after consecutive days featuring temperatures reaching up to 40 degrees.

Human populations are also bearing the brunt of the extreme climate conditions. According to national health data, more than 43,000 people across Japan have required hospital admission for heatstroke over the course of the summer season. Urban areas like Tokyo’s Shinjuku district have seen pedestrians rely heavily on parasols and public cooling stations to navigate the sweltering streets.
